Eye For Eye, Flight For Flight

04.07.2006, 18:27
The Federal Agency of Air Transport plan to tighten control over operating international charter flights by Russian Airline Companies. The analysis of charter flight regularity showed that summarizing the results of May and June, some airlines could not ensure airpark reservation. As a result, according to the FAAT, KD-avia had 29 delays for 3 hours and more, VIM-avia – 25 delays, that is correspondingly 12% and 6% of a total number of operated charters. Therefore, it was decided that in July the Rosaviation will not accept applications for additional charter flights from the Airlines. According to unaccredited sources, a number of declines will be equal to a number of delays. Commenting on the situation, the FAAT pointed out that the measure is a warning for the charter market. Thus, Evgeny Bachurin, the Head Deputy of Rosaviation, said: ‘the measure is aimed at avoiding situations when airlines plan more charters than they can operate properly. It is a violation of passengers’ rights’. He also added: ‘we will control the situation. It was decided to analyze the regularity of flights on a monthly basis. We will take restrictive measures towards airlines which do not meet the set standard’. On July 4th representatives of KD-avia and VIM-avia were unavailable for comments.
